How to Cut, Copy, and Paste in the Terminal
If you're new to the Terminal, Pasting Commands probably seems like a godsend. Until it doesn't work. Here's how to do it properly.Cutting, Copying and Pasting
This is actually very simple to do.In most applications Cut, Copy and Paste are Ctrl + X, Ctrl + C and Ctrl+V respectively.
In the Terminal, Ctrl+C is Cancel Command. The others do things to, but that's not important.
To paste (probably the one you'll use the most), use Ctrl + Shift + V.
Use X or C appropriately for cutting and copying.
